Термостат на arduino

Rizhiy
Offline
Зарегистрирован: 17.10.2016

Доброе время суток, господа! Очень уважаю ваш род деятельности, но нужна помощь новичку. По поиску не смог найти полного ответа на мой вопрос. Сразу к делу: нужно 20 литров нагревать на определенную температуру с погрешностью в 0.1 градус. При этом, нужен нужен диспей, на котором указывается текущее время работы (опционно, т.е. не обязательно), текущая немпература и температура, которой придерживаться. Так-же, нужны мне кнопки, что бы управлять всеми этимии параметрами. Так вот, подскажите пожалуйста, какие узлы необходимы для этой задумки и как подключать нагревательный элемент (800+ Вт). Пригодятся все схемы и все коды. Спасибо большое.

yul-i-an
yul-i-an аватар
Offline
Зарегистрирован: 10.12.2012
dmitron1036
Offline
Зарегистрирован: 10.01.2016

1) 0.1 градус - это не просто.

Во-первых нужен правильный датчик.

Во-вторых надо подумать как его разместить.

В третьих надо с него суметь снять данные с заявленной точностью.

В четвёртых 20 литров воды с точностью 0,1 градус нагреть невозможно.

так что проект неосуществим.

ramen
ramen аватар
Offline
Зарегистрирован: 19.02.2015

Термостатов наделано уже большое количество, но уж сильно маленькую погрешность хотите в 20 литровом то баке, если погружать датчик (самое оптимальное) то сам использовал водонепроницаемый 18b20 http://fastnvr.ru/arduino_magazin/arduino_datchiki/datchik-temperatury-vodonepronicaemyy но у него погрешность 0.5, да и анриал в большом объеме уследить изменение температуры, т.к. нагрев неравномерный же в любом случае. Больше опорных данных предоставьте, а по коду тут дело на 10 минут

bwn
Offline
Зарегистрирован: 25.08.2014

ramen пишет:

но у него погрешность 0.5

Не соглашусь, это погрешность по абсолютной температуре, а по относительной все у него в порядке. У меня в ректификаторе пашет второй год. Проблема только в низкой дискретизации - 0,0625гр. У меня выходит до аварийного состояния 3 шага, у Т.С будет всего один.
А 0,1гр по всему объему 20л канистры, думаю из области фантастики.

Rizhiy
Offline
Зарегистрирован: 17.10.2016

Спасибо за отзыв. Так как я человек неопытный в термостатах, сделаю некоторые поправки: ок, 0.1 - слишком точная погрешность, опускаем до 0.5 градусов; объем тоже уменьшим - 15 литров. По плану разместить насос, который будет создавать циркуляцию воды в ведре (забирающая его часть и выбрасывающая будут размещены по радиусу, вызывая более-менее равномерную циркуляцию). С датчиком определились, остальное я найду по ссылкам автора первого ответа. Что по поводу кода?

Rizhiy
Offline
Зарегистрирован: 17.10.2016

И да, размещение. Тут нужен совет. По плану - размещение сбоку ведра (устройство будет в корпусе из нержавейки - коробки размерами 600х100х50, думаю и датчик будет там-же). Вот и думаю, как разместить и датчик, и элемент нагрева, что бы этот элемент не нагревал сам датчик

Goodawel
Offline
Зарегистрирован: 05.11.2017

Вопрос больше не актуален.